Preventing water system pollution
To prevent pollution from wastewater discharged into the water circulation system, the University has implemented the following wastewater treatment processes: All laboratories are required to recycle waste liquids generated during experiments, and no waste liquids are permitted to be poured into drainage channels. Additionally, our wastewater treatment plant employs processes such as Sequencing Batch Reactor (SBR) activated sludge, sand filtration, A2O, membrane bioreactors (MBR), and other necessary chemical treatments to ensure that wastewater meets legal effluent standards, thereby reducing environmental impact.
